Output 5436659deea10561e6ca504eb0f1251fed7bb40abeef3b9b0b41a2128fcb5877:5

value
3075877
script pubkey
OP_0 OP_PUSHBYTES_20 3889af6c6d1f030d494e3ad869565c15fd3454f1
address
bc1q8zy67mrdrups6j2w8tvxj4juzh7ng483ltcgyn
transaction
5436659deea10561e6ca504eb0f1251fed7bb40abeef3b9b0b41a2128fcb5877
spent
true